Aon's Cyber Solutions is looking for a Cyber Summer Associate! Locations: New York, Chicago, Seattle, Los Angeles, Washington DC, Boston, Minneapolis, Charlotte, Dallas US Recruiting Timeline APPLICATIONS DUE BY: Friday, February 4, 2022January/February - Applications accepted and first round interviews February/March - Final round interviews and offers extended June 2022 - Cyber Summer Associate Program begins  About Cyber Solutions: Aon’s Cyber Solutions offers holistic cyber risk management, unsurpassed investigative skills, and proprietary technologies to help clients uncover and quantify cyber risks, protect critical assets, and recover from cyber incidents.  Position Overview: The Cyber Summer Associate Program is a ten-week internship in one area of Aon's Cyber Solutions, where we will immerse you in our proactive and reactive services. You will work on client projects and learn key skills in information and physical security: digital forensics; penetration testing (ethical hacking); and trade secret protection; incident response (i.e. working with an organization in response to a cyber-attack); and security advisory (i.e. proactively identifying vulnerabilities and remediation).  This paid internship begins in June with a three-day training program (typically) in one of our U.S. offices, bringing together all of the Cyber Summer Associates. During this time, you will meet with firm leadership, participate in a Capture the Flag exercise, network with colleagues, and join other special events.  Cyber Summer Associates work directly with our existing employees in one of our U.S. offices. Immersed in our experienced client teams, you will contribute to a wide variety of client projects. You will learn how to use cutting-edge tools and technologies, and attend regular training and demos to build technical and professional skills. Throughout the summer, you will complete a research project on an impactful topic relevant to your skillsets and interests, and present it to the firm's leadership at the end of the program.  From the very beginning, you will be learning from managers and colleagues with robust technical and legal backgrounds, many of whom contributed directly to developing the foundations of the practice of cyber-focused law enforcement.
